Live Your Strategic Plan: A Framework for Facilitating Campus Engagement
Delivered April 3, 2025Planning Types: Strategic PlanningChallenges: Engaging Stakeholders, Planning AlignmentTraditional strategic planning can lead to a static plan that does little to inspire implementation or true change. This session will detail a process that promotes buy-in and engagement while providing structured frameworks to support implementation and assessment. Our framework provides support for a campus community to 'live' its institutional strategic plan through the strategic planning cycle (SPC) at the unit level, informing the realization of institutional goals and outcomes. We'll provide our tools and approaches for you to access and review, as well as the rationale for developing support for your own campus communities to 'live' their strategic plan.
Learning Outcomes:
- Outline the SPC framework from planning to implementation to assessment to your unit.
- Detail a collaborative process to engage stakeholders while increasing buy-in to 'live' a strategic plan.
- Support campus community members to develop a meaningful, actionable strategic plan for their unit.
- Explain the SPC framework rationale for facilitating teams to develop a strategic plan as well as align, implement, assess, improve, and evaluate the impact of the plan.
